What It Is
A full-coverage, matte-finish liquid foundation with SPF 15. Available in 65 shades across the full spectrum of skin tones and undertones. Retails for $40 at MAC counters and Sephora. The formula was updated in 2023 with improved skincare ingredients.
How It Performs
Studio Fix Fluid is a workhorse. It covers everything — redness, hyperpigmentation, acne, dark circles — with one to two layers. The matte finish is true matte, not satin, which makes it the best choice for oily skin and for photography where shine is the enemy.
Wear time is genuinely impressive: 10-12 hours on most skin types without touch-ups. On oily skin, it's the longest-wearing foundation I've tested at this price point.
Who It's For
Oily to combination skin. Anyone who wants full coverage. Makeup artists and professionals who need reliability. Brides. Anyone who photographs frequently.
Who Should Skip It
Dry skin (the matte finish can look powdery and emphasize texture). Mature skin (same issue). Anyone who wants a natural or dewy finish.
Final Verdict
MAC Studio Fix Fluid is a classic for a reason. It's not the most sophisticated formula on the market, but for full coverage and long wear on oily skin, it remains one of the best options at any price point. The 65-shade range is unmatched in the industry.
